#49950e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#49950e is composed of 28.6% red, 58.4%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51% cyan, 0% magenta, 90.6%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 93.8 degrees, a saturation of 82.8% and a lightness of 32%. #49950e color hex could be obtained by blending #92ff1c with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#49950e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030601 is the darkest color, while #f8fef3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#49950e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#51564d is the less saturated color, while #47a201 is the most saturated one.
